Saz: The Palestinian Rapper for Change
This fascinating documentary explores the life and music of Saz, an Arab rapper living in a Jewish neighborhood who offers up a unique perspective as he creates music he hopes will aid in the reconciliation between Israel and Palestine. Believing people of differing viewpoints can come together as they enjoy his music, Saz travels from Tel Aviv and Haifa to London, presenting his own kind of musical peace treaty wherever he goes.

📋 Film Details
| Year | 2006 |
| Genre | Documentary, Music |
| Director | Gil Karni |
| Runtime | 51 min. |
